Welcome to the Spokewise rebalancing tool. Spokewise computes nightly dock-redistribution plans for the Averlane bike-share network and pushes van routes to the dispatch app. As release manager, you own the weekly cut: tag the build, run the migration check, and confirm the planner smoke test against staging before promoting. All planner state lives in the rebalance database, which you must be able to reach before tagging. Connect using the string below.

replica DSN, kajep-yahag: mssql://praok_svc:iF@db-8d68.plorvaio.local:5432/eliion

## Session Handling for Health Checks

The Corvel gateway sits behind the Lanternside load balancer, which probes /healthz every ten seconds. Health-check requests are stateless by design: they bypass the session store entirely so that probe traffic never inflates session counts or evicts real user sessions. New team members should note that the deep-check endpoint, /healthz/deep, does verify session-store connectivity and therefore requires authentication. When probing it manually, supply the token below.

bearer token for tajep-kajef: eyJhbGciOiJIUzI1NiIsInR5cCI6IkpXVCJ9.eyJzdWIiOiIoOsZ23In0.CsygO0hs

## Step 4: Swap out QueueLite

OK, plugin folks — time to ditch the old homegrown QueueLite shim. Korvid 2.0 ships a proper broker-backed scheduler, so delete your `queuelite_adapter` calls and register jobs via the new `korvid.jobs` hook instead. Retries and dead-lettering are handled for you now. Point your plugin at these scheduler settings.

config for kafof-bawef:
holath:
  log_level: debug
  metrics_host: metrics.holath.qorvelsys.internal
  pin: 2191
  pool_size: 32